Surgery Information / Job Description
We have an exciting opportunity for a Veterinary Surgeon to come and join our very well established business of 17 years at Vets4Pets Oldham. This small animal practice is based at a very convenient location on a busy retail park with ample car parking and close to the motorway network.
While we are an established practice we have new management with our Vet Partner Barbara Hambley who qualified from Liverpool in 1999 and has worked in the area for 12 years. Barbara is really keen to make the practice somewhere that provides excellent care and is a very friendly and supportive place to work.
The bright, air-conditioned surgery is purpose built to industry leading standards and has equipment including digital x-ray, ultrasound, BP, ECG, operating theatre and in-house lab. We are a very motivated, enthusiastic and welcoming team at the practice where we currently have 1 permanent vet and a regular locum, 4 nurses and 4 reception colleagues. By joining us, you’ll become part of a progressive surgery dedicated to providing the highest standards of care to clients and their pets.
Person Specification
We are looking for an experienced Veterinary Surgeon (at least 18 months experience) on a full or part time basis. We are looking for someone who is confident with routine surgeries and consulting, is friendly and enthusiastic with strong communication. The practice provides full support and encouragement and allows clinical freedom for continued personal growth and development. There will 1 in 3 weekends but you will be pleased to hear there are no OOH.

Being part of the Pets At Home Group
Being part of Vets for Pets means you’ll be part of our network of locally owned practices. Our practices are located across the country and are owned and run by our Joint Venture Partners (JVPs). Our Joint Venture Partnership model is unique and gives everyone the best of both worlds. Working within one of our practices you’ll get to work with the JVP who has the clinical freedom and autonomy to do things their own way.
As we’re part of a large respected organisation you’ll also enjoy the benefits of being part of a wider PLC Group. This means we can give you greater stability and job security during these uncertain times and beyond.
